A luxury coupe competing in one of Africa's most punishing rallies sounds unlikely, but Mercedes committed seriously to the Bandama with the 450 SLC, and this replica documents that effort.

Diecast Detail on an Unusual Rally Subject

The sealed diecast body here carries the SLC's long wheelbase and coupe roofline as one continuous casting, a genuinely distinctive silhouette among rally subjects that tend toward compact hatchbacks and saloons. The #4 livery, with its bold numbering and sponsor branding, is applied through tampo printing that holds crisp edges even at 1:43, a scale that leaves little room for error on dense graphics. Rally-spec details like underbody protection and auxiliary lighting are cast in as surface detail rather than fitted separately, keeping the sealed construction consistent with the rest of the model. The finish carries an even gloss across the SLC's long flanks, letting the livery read cleanly from a shelf distance.

A Distinctive Chapter in Rally History

The Rally du Bandama, run through Ivory Coast, demanded exceptional durability from cars and crews alike, and Mercedes's decision to campaign a big luxury coupe there rather than a purpose-built rally car remains one of the more unusual footnotes in the sport's history. For a collector focused on WRC classic and endurance rallying specifically, this SLC offers a genuinely different subject to the more familiar Lancia and Audi entries of the same era. At 1:43, it pairs interestingly with other period rally cars, highlighting just how varied the sport's approach to car choice once was.
